🧠 The Strengths of Introverts (That Go Overlooked)
If you’re introverted, you’ve been gifted with qualities that the world deeply needs:
🌀 Deep Focus
While others are scattered in the noise, you know how to enter flow states that produce clarity, creativity, and genius.
🧏 Intentional Listening
You don’t listen to respond—you listen to understand. And that makes you a better communicator than most extroverts who dominate conversations.
🧭 Inner Compass
You’re self-guided. Less influenced by trends or crowds. That authenticity is rare—and magnetic.
🌱 Empathy and Intuition
Because you observe, you pick up on what others miss. You sense energy shifts. You care deeply, even if you don’t say it out loud.
🎯 Precision Over Performance
You don’t speak to fill space. When you speak, it matters—and people remember.
